Labour standards should be investigated in Georgia

10 junio, 2011In a joint letter to the European Commission, ITUC and ETUC call for a European Union investigation of anti-union laws in Georgia. The investigation should be conducted under the EU's system of trade preferences granted to Georgia.

Bitter Christmas for Mexican workers

22 diciembre, 2010IMF has received reports of renewed attacks against trade unionists and activists these last days in Mexico. José Luis Solorio, General Secretary of the new democratic Honda union in El Salto, Jalisco was fired; Jorge Mora, elected trade union leader in the Platosa Mine in la Sierrita, Durango also fired and his co-workers intimidated; in Puebla, the office of labour activists CAT, Centre for Worker Support was ransacked and robbed. IMF calls on the affiliates to send strong protest letters to support the Mexican workers fighting for freedom of association and justice.

Union activists arrested after the elections in Belarus

23 diciembre, 2010In the evening of December 19, mass demonstrations were staged in Minsk. Four trade unionists were arrested. The IMF demands the immediate release of Michael Kovalkov, Alexei Kovun, Vladimir Sergeev and Alexander Tysevich and an end of the violations of fundamental human rights in Belarus.
